Editorial Review for Picnic – by Lauren McCutcheon

In Short
Gaze into the deli case to see the culinary gifts of Chef Anne-Marie Lasher (who directed Fork's kitchen). Don't miss the romaine and Gorgonzola salad, dressed in honey-garlic and mixed with spiced pecans, or any one of Lasher's dips, hearty sandwiches or nightly dinners-to-go. Count on great chocolate-espresso brownies and lemon bars and decadent pot de creme. What's more, Picnic will gladly pack a basket with a meal (or just goodies), and send you on your way.
